Output 8b57a5ce18c1ed3a7b82bd1e8c042b8b14a038868d2fb88e6fc0805e697bf4fb:0

value
26453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77edf6e402ebba4229b59f075798b52d67266ea OP_EQUAL
address
3JRFZvXiqmeJuFR2TwUBQARbdAYwLzZjUR
transaction
8b57a5ce18c1ed3a7b82bd1e8c042b8b14a038868d2fb88e6fc0805e697bf4fb
confirmations
188777
spent
true